  3. AUSTRALIA CELEBRATES THE CORONATION

    Five hundred thousand excited people—almost half of the entire population of Melbourne—sang and danced in city streets tonight to celebrate the crowning of Queen Elizabeth. Scores of elderly women fainted and children were lost in the crowds ... [ILLUSTRATED]
